WATER (GENERAL) REGULATIONS 2021 - REG 27

Transfer of entitlements between water corporations

If an employee ceases to be employed by a water corporation (the former water corporation ) and within 2 months of ceasing to be so employed is employed by another water corporation (the current water corporation ), the current water corporation must, within 6 months of the commencement of the employee's employment, inform the former water corporation of the employee's employment and the former water corporation must within 30 days of being so informed pay to the current water corporation an amount equal to 10% of 3 months current pay for each completed year of service of the employee with the following persons or bodies if that service would be included in computing the period of service entitling the employee to long service leave under these Regulations—

        (a)     the former water corporation or any person or body in relation to which that former water corporation is the successor in law;

        (b)     any other water corporation or any person or body in relation to which that other water corporation is the successor in law;

        (c)     a person or body referred to in regulation 23(3).
